Shots Screen
This screen allows the user to edit shot definitions. The
contents of this screen change based on the flow units
selection. Shots are defined by flow rate and weight or
time (duration). See Home Screen, Shot Mode on
page 70 for information on how to use predefined shots.
NOTE: 100 shot definitions are available across ten
pages.
To edit a shot definition:
1. Press then use the arrow keys to navigate to the
desired value.
2. Type the new value then press to accept the
new value.
3. If desired, press to quickly enter the same value
for the rate and time/volume/weight.
4. Repeat step 2 as required.
